Skip to content

Commit

Permalink
Lower case resource name when determining URL
Browse files Browse the repository at this point in the history
  • Loading branch information
fabianvf committed Jan 3, 2019
1 parent 307dd81 commit 59f8db1
Showing 1 changed file with 5 additions and 4 deletions.
9 changes: 5 additions & 4 deletions openshift/dynamic/client.py
Original file line number Diff line number Diff line change
Expand Up @@ -358,11 +358,12 @@ def __repr__(self):
@property
def urls(self):
full_prefix = '{}/{}'.format(self.prefix, self.group_version)
resource_name = self.name.lower()
return {
'base': '/{}/{}'.format(full_prefix, self.name),
'namespaced_base': '/{}/namespaces/{{namespace}}/{}'.format(full_prefix, self.name),
'full': '/{}/{}/{{name}}'.format(full_prefix, self.name),
'namespaced_full': '/{}/namespaces/{{namespace}}/{}/{{name}}'.format(full_prefix, self.name)
'base': '/{}/{}'.format(full_prefix, resource_name),
'namespaced_base': '/{}/namespaces/{{namespace}}/{}'.format(full_prefix, resource_name),
'full': '/{}/{}/{{name}}'.format(full_prefix, resource_name),
'namespaced_full': '/{}/namespaces/{{namespace}}/{}/{{name}}'.format(full_prefix, resource_name)
}

def path(self, name=None, namespace=None):
Expand Down

0 comments on commit 59f8db1

Please sign in to comment.